Canadian Regulations on Anabolic Steroids

Navigating the judicial system surrounding steroids in copyright can be complex. While anabolic agents are generally banned for use in sport and athletics, their legal status outside of this context is more nuanced. Possession and distribution of steroids without a valid prescription from a doctor can result in criminal charges under the Controlled Drugs and Substances Act. However, personal use may not always be subject to the same level of harsh consequences.

  • Ultimately, the legal ramifications of steroid use in copyright can vary depending on a number of factors, including the specific circumstances, quantities involved, and intent.

Grasping Canadian Steroid Laws

copyright has stringent laws regarding the possession, use, and supply of anabolic steroids. These substances are classified as controlled drugs under the Controlled Drugs and Substances Act. Possessing steroids without a valid prescription from a licensed physician is illegal.

Penalties for violating these laws can be strict, including fines, imprisonment, or both. It's essential to grasp the legal consequences associated with steroid use in copyright.
